Transaction 16c6cfd7065f656a58cd0475ae979c7e49353953d9d37e35571f3b901fb40276

56 Input
2 Outputs
  • 16c6cfd7065f656a58cd0475ae979c7e49353953d9d37e35571f3b901fb40276:0
  • value  288721
    address  164cfMd9Yiv1pTohSi6Yk9E7F9MHRYxLeE
  • 16c6cfd7065f656a58cd0475ae979c7e49353953d9d37e35571f3b901fb40276:1
  • value  60623500
    address  3Ja5fsAA53jPC4Ynm3A5KFhWydgHL5hfAA